What You’ll Do:
- Long-haul driving: You will be delivering freight across the UK, often spending nights away in your vehicle.
- Bay-to-bay delivery only, with no manual handling: All deliveries are drop-and-go (bay-to-bay), meaning you won’t be lifting goods.
- Drive a modern, well-maintained fleet; you should also be confident in basic navigation and journey planning.
- Follow all road safety rules and company policies, including rest breaks and driving hours.
- Carry out daily checks and report any issues – we pride ourselves on running a reliable, safe fleet.
- Use of SNAP accounts and fuel cards for ease on the road.
- Consistent work with 5 consecutive tramping shifts Sun-Fri.
Requirements:
- Full UK C+E License (Class 1): You must hold a valid Class 1 license to operate articulated vehicles.
- Minimum 2 years of HGV experience: We're looking for drivers who are confident on UK roads and understand industry expectations.
- Clean license preferred: We accept up to 6 points, but no serious endorsements such as TT (disqualification), DR (drink driving), or IN (insurance offences).
- Fluency in English Language (preferred)
- UK road law knowledge: Understanding the Highway Code, rest break rules, and HGV-specific regulations.
- Right to work in the UK: You must have valid documents confirming your eligibility.
- Safety first – all drivers must pass pre-employment screening (drug and alcohol test, background check).
